CD19-targeting CAR T Cells for B Cell Lymphoma

NCT02547948 · Status: WITHDRAWN · Phase: PHASE1/P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L

Last updated 2020-07-16

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the safety and efficacy of CD19-targeting CAR T Cells infusion for B Cell Lymphoma.

Conditions

  • B Cell Lymphoma

Interventions

BIOLOGICAL

CD19-targeting CAR T Cells infusion

CD19-targeting 2nd generation CAR t cells infusion for refractory B cell lymphoma
